Man Critical After Jumping From 2nd Story Window Of Jersey City Home Man Critical After Jumping From 2nd Story Window Of Jersey City Home
Man Critical After Jumping From 2nd Story Window Of Jersey City Home A man who plunged out of a second-story window over the weekend was in critical condition as of Monday, officials said. Police observed the 46-year-old man jump out of the window at 12 Wegman Ct., around 1 p.m. on Jan. 2, Jersey City spokeswoman Kimberly Wallace Scalcione said. He was taken to a local hospital with serious injuries. It was not clear why he jumped and no further details were being released.

Elderly Man Fights Off Raccoon Walking Dogs In Hunterdon County Park Elderly Man Fights Off Raccoon Walking Dogs In Hunterdon County Park
Elderly Man Fights Off Raccoon Walking Dogs In Hunterdon County Park An elderly man walking his dogs was attacked by a raccoon in a Hunterdon County park over the weekend. The animal bit the 79-year-old man's pants legs and refused to let go in Christie Hoffman Farm Park in Tewksbury, around 7 p.m. Friday, Chief Tim Barlow said. The man was able to fight off the raccoon, and later went to a local hospital for treatment for scratches to his arm. Neither of his dogs were hurt, police said.
